According to a recent Zety survey, although cover letter submission is labeled optional in applications, 89% of recruiters actually expect them. More than 80% of recruiters reject applicants based solely on their cover letters. Jasmine Escalera, a career expert at Zety, emphasizes that tailoring cover letters is crucial, as they should connect an applicant's experience directly to the job requirements instead of merely repeating their résumé. This highlights the cover letter's role as a vital tool in job applications.
Job applications are super complicated today. You have to tailor your résumé to the job, and there are often so many moving parts to just submit one application.
Sometimes it can be equally as important as résumés when a recruiter is looking for a specific kind of individual to work within their company.
Cover letters matter. More than 80% of recruiters have rejected applicants based solely on their cover letters, according to Zety.
The most important focus of the cover letter is to connect the dots between your experience and the demands of the role.
